Output ef124662cf5b14a60d0fd29f4f0e6750ca31b644c97c4dbf48ad86b2adf7f024:0

value
32395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80af6b61a46552889842dddf04a54d4d182297f2 OP_EQUAL
address
3DRSZTPGKRJMDTFuUEKJDjdVxneGAo4Emr
transaction
ef124662cf5b14a60d0fd29f4f0e6750ca31b644c97c4dbf48ad86b2adf7f024
spent
true